What is the statute of limitations for filing a lawsuit in a civil case in Costa Rica?

The statute of limitations for filing a lawsuit in a civil case in Costa Rica varies depending on the type of case and the applicable law. For example, the deadline for filing a breach of contract claim may be different than for a personal injury case. It is important to consult with an attorney to determine the appropriate deadline in a specific case, as these deadlines should not be exceeded, or the right to file a lawsuit will be lost.
